UNITED STATES v. O'DELL

No. 3053.

61 F.Supp. 966 (1945)

UNITED STATES v. O'DELL.

District Court, E. D. Michigan, S. D.

June 29, 1945.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

United States District Attorney, for plaintiff.

Meyers & Keys, of Detroit, Mich., for defendant.


PICARD, District Judge.

The government herein sues defendant personally to collect certain social security taxes that were assessed against the Howie Company for which he became trustee. The action is under Section 3710(a) and (b), 26 U.S.C.A.
